Derrick Rose was listening throughout Thursday’s game as Denver Nuggets coaches instructed their players in-game on how to guard the former MVP.

So when Rose, whose shooting slump had continued much of the evening, pulled up from 21 feet on the left wing – right in front of the Denver bench – and buried a jumper to give the Bulls a five-point lead with 24.2 seconds left, he looked back and stared down the Nuggets bench.

“I’m not going to let anyone dictate the way that I play,” Rose said after the Bulls’ 106-101 victory, their tenth in the last 12 games. “They’re giving me shots, I’m going to take them. Shots that I normally make, I’m going to keep taking them. I could care less about what anyone says or talks about my game. They’re giving me shots, I should be able to make them shots.”
